Denso Spark Plug Multi-ground electrodes specified by engine manufacurer for unusual combustion chamber design, click on Multi-ground for more info. Copper core for better thermal conductivity. Machine rolled threads to reduce cross-threading and seizing . The plug insulator is constructed of purified alumina powder for extreme stress with 5 ribs to prevent flashover. Technical Specifications - 14mm Thread, 19mm (3/4") Reach, 5/8" (16mm) Hex Size, Gasket Seat, Resistor, Projected Tip, Triple Ground Electrodes, Removable Terminal Nut, Semi Surface Gap, .040" Gap
